from neutron._i18n import _LI
|
|
from neutron.common import exceptions as n_exc
|
|
from oslo_config import cfg
|
|
from oslo_log import log as logging
|
|
import stevedore
|
|
|
|
from gbpservice.neutron.services.servicechain.plugins.ncp import config # noqa
|
|
from gbpservice.neutron.services.servicechain.plugins.ncp import model
|
|
|
|
LOG = logging.getLogger(__name__)
|
|
|
|
|
|
class NodeDriverManager(stevedore.named.NamedExtensionManager):
|
|
"""Route servicechain APIs to servicechain node drivers.
|
|
|
|
"""
|
|
|
|
def __init__(self):
|
|
# Registered node drivers, keyed by name.
|
|
self.drivers = {}
|
|
# Ordered list of node drivers.
|
|
self.ordered_drivers = []
|
|
names = cfg.CONF.node_composition_plugin.node_drivers
|
|
LOG.info(_LI("Configured service chain node driver names: %s"), names)
|
|
super(NodeDriverManager,
|
|
self).__init__(
|
|
'gbpservice.neutron.servicechain.ncp_drivers', names,
|
|
invoke_on_load=True, name_order=True)
|
|
LOG.info(_LI(
|
|
"Loaded service chain node driver names: %s"), self.names())
|
|
self._register_drivers()
|
|
|
|
def _register_drivers(self):
|
|
"""Register all service chain node drivers."""
|
|
for ext in self:
|
|
self.drivers[ext.name] = ext
|
|
self.ordered_drivers.append(ext)
|
|
LOG.info(_LI("Registered service chain node drivers: %s"),
|
|
[driver.name for driver in self.ordered_drivers])
|
|
|
|
def initialize(self):
|
|
"""Initialize all the service chain node drivers."""
|
|
self.native_bulk_support = True
|
|
for driver in self.ordered_drivers:
|
|
LOG.info(_LI("Initializing service chain node drivers '%s'"),
|
|
driver.name)
|
|
driver.obj.initialize(driver.name)
|
|
self.native_bulk_support &= getattr(driver.obj,
|
|
'native_bulk_support', True)
|
|
|
|
def schedule_deploy(self, context):
|
|
"""Schedule Node Driver for Node creation.
|
|
|
|
Given a NodeContext, this method returns the driver capable of creating
|
|
the specific node.
|
|
"""
|
|
for driver in self.ordered_drivers:
|
|
try:
|
|
driver.obj.validate_create(context)
|
|
model.set_node_owner(context, driver.obj.name)
|
|
return driver.obj
|
|
except n_exc.NeutronException as e:
|
|
LOG.warning(e.message)
|
|
|
|
def schedule_destroy(self, context):
|
|
"""Schedule Node Driver for Node disruption.
|
|
|
|
Given a NodeContext, this method returns the driver capable of
|
|
destroying the specific node.
|
|
"""
|
|
driver = self.get_owning_driver(context)
|
|
if driver:
|
|
model.unset_node_owner(context)
|
|
return driver
|
|
|
|
def schedule_update(self, context):
|
|
"""Schedule Node Driver for Node Update.
|
|
|
|
Given a NodeContext, this method returns the driver capable of updating
|
|
the specific node.
|
|
"""
|
|
driver = self.get_owning_driver(context)
|
|
if driver:
|
|
driver.validate_update(context)
|
|
return driver
|
|
|
|
def clear_node_owner(self, context):
|
|
"""Remove Node Driver ownership set for a Node
|
|
|
|
Given a NodeContext, this method removes the Node owner mapping in DB.
|
|
This method is used when we want to perform a disruptive chain update
|
|
by deleting and recreating the Node instances
|
|
"""
|
|
model.unset_node_owner(context)
|
|
|
|
def get_owning_driver(self, context):
|
|
owner = model.get_node_owner(context)
|
|
if owner:
|
|
driver = self.drivers.get(owner[0].driver_name)
|
|
return driver.obj if driver else None
